    • Funeral services for Charley A. Hillard, 86, of Homer, who died at 9 a.m. Friday, Dec. 15, 1978, at Lakeview Medical Center, Danville, were conducted Monday afternoon at Kirby Funeral Home, Homer, with the Rev. Berton Helein officiating. Burial was in Homer GAR Cemetery.
      Mr. Hlllard was born May 27 1892, near Louisville, Ky., a son of John Hillard.
      He was married to Ada Yeazel who preceded him in death in 1975. He was also preceded in death by his parents, two brothers and three sisters.
      Survivors include one son, Chester, of Yuma, Ariz.; one granddaughter and three great-grandchildren.
      He was a member of the Evangelical Methodist Church of Fairmount.
